How are disney exclusive toy story figures made?

Quick Answer

Disney exclusive Toy Story figures are typically produced by molding plastic components, painting them with detailed graphics, and assembling them with articulated joints before being packaged for retail.

Explanation

The creation of a Disney exclusive Toy Story figure begins with a detailed design that captures the character’s appearance from the films. Designers create prototype molds, which are then refined through several iterations to ensure accurate proportions and joint placement. Once a final mold is approved, the manufacturer uses injection molding to produce the plastic parts in large batches. After molding, each piece is polished, painted with high‑resolution graphics, and assembled by hand or semi‑automated processes, attaching movable joints, accessories, and any special features. Quality control checks verify the paint finish, articulation, and overall finish before the figures are packaged in branded boxes and shipped to retailers. Because these figures are marked as Disney exclusive, they often include limited‑edition packaging or special artwork that distinguishes them from standard releases, making them desirable for collectors.
